Description

Gateway to former Weston House, erected c.1820. Splayed walls from road lead to low roughly coursed squared limestone screen wall with stone copings, flanking vehicular entrance with panelled cut-stone piers with moulded cornices and squat pyramidal caps and double-leaf cast-iron gates, with carved stone wheel guards in advance of gate.

Appraisal

This gateway, with its well crafted panelled stone piers and cast-iron gates, reflects the quality of the now-demolished Weston House, an early nineteenth-century three-bay two-storey house, in its small demesne.
